About Furazolidone Tablets Ip 100 Mg
Furazolidone Tablets Ip 100 Mg (Furazolidone) is an antibiotic used to treat bacterial infections. It works by killing bacteria or preventing their growth. It is important to take this medication exactly as prescribed by your doctor.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and headache. Avoid alcohol while taking furazolidone. If you are pregnant, breastfeeding, or have any health conditions, talk to your doctor before taking this medication.
Ingredients of Furazolidone Tablets Ip 100 Mg

    Furazolidone

    Furazolidone is the active ingredient in this medication.It is a type of antibiotic known as a nitrofuran.

Direction for Use of Furazolidone Tablets Ip 100 Mg

Furazolidone is used to treat certain types of bacterial infections, including:

    Infections of the digestive tract (like diarrhea)

    Infections of the urinary tract

    Infections of the skin

    It may also be used to prevent certain types of bacterial infections.

How Furazolidone Tablets Ip 100 Mg Works

Furazolidone Tablets Ip 100 Mg (Furazolidone) works by killing bacteria or preventing their growth. It does this by interfering with the bacteria's ability to produce essential proteins.

Storage and Handling of Furazolidone Tablets Ip 100 Mg

Store furazolidone at room temperature, away from light and moisture. Keep it out of reach of children and pets.

Dosage of Furazolidone Tablets Ip 100 Mg

    The dosage of furazolidone will vary depending on your condition, age, and overall health. Always follow your doctor's instructions carefully.

    Furazolidone is usually taken by mouth with a glass of water.

    Take furazolidone exactly as prescribed by your doctor. Do not take more or less of it, or take it for a longer period than prescribed.

Safety Consideration or Warnings
    Alcohol Consumption

    Avoid consuming alcohol while taking furazolidone as it can increase the risk of side effects.

    While Driving or Operating Machinery

    Furazolidone can cause dizziness. Avoid driving or operating machinery until you know how this medication affects you.

    Pregnant & Breastfeeding Women

    Furazolidone can be harmful to an unborn baby. It is not recommended for use during pregnancy. It is also not recommended for use during breastfeeding as it can pass into breast milk.

    Children

    Furazolidone is not recommended for use in children under the age of 1 month.

    Kidney

    If you have kidney problems, talk to your doctor before taking furazolidone.

    Liver

    If you have liver problems, talk to your doctor before taking furazolidone.
